How to Guard Your Heart in a Noisy World

 

Core Focus:

Protecting spiritual focus in a distracted age.

Key Points:

What you consume shapes your faith

Guarding your heart is a daily choice

Peace requires boundaries

Scripture Support:

Proverbs 4:23

Romans 12:2

Philippians 4:8

Phil.4.8 - Finally, brethren, whatsoever things are true, whatsoever things are honest, whatsoever things are just, whatsoever things are pure, whatsoever things are lovely, whatsoever things are of good report; if there be any virtue, and if there be any praise, think on these things.

This is very important for protecting your spiritual focus.

Faith Is Not Just Belief — It Is Daily Practice

  Many people believe in God, yet struggle to live out their faith daily. Why? Because faith is often misunderstood as belief alone, instead of action inspired by belief. True faith shows up in how we respond to  difficulties, treat others, and trust God when things don’t make sense. What Practical Faith Looks Like Choosing prayer over panic Trusting God even when answers delay Showing love when it’s uncomfortable Obeying God in small, everyday decisions Biblical Insight “For as the body without the spirit is dead, so faith without works is dead also.” — James 2:26 Faith grows when we practice it — one step at a time. Closing Thought Start small. God honors obedience, not perfection .
